只会sql可以维护mes系统吗
-
已被采纳为最佳回答
只会SQL不一定能独立维护MES系统,但具备SQL技能可以帮助你理解数据管理、提高数据查询效率、优化数据处理流程。 MES(制造执行系统)不仅涉及数据查询,还包括系统的配置、维护和集成等多个方面。尽管SQL在数据操作中至关重要,但维护MES系统需要对其架构、功能模块、硬件接口等有全面的理解。尤其是对MES系统的业务流程和生产管理的深入了解,能够帮助维护人员更有效地解决问题。例如,了解如何利用SQL进行数据分析,可以帮助企业优化生产过程、提高效率,但若没有对MES系统整体架构和功能的理解,可能无法充分发挥这些分析的作用。
一、MES系统的基本概念
MES(Manufacturing Execution System)是一种用于生产过程管理的系统,旨在通过实时监控和控制生产环节,提高生产效率和产品质量。MES系统通常连接企业的ERP(企业资源计划)系统和生产设备,实现数据的无缝流动。它不仅负责收集生产数据,还能够对生产计划、进度、物料管理等进行实时跟踪和优化。一般来说,MES系统的主要功能包括生产调度、质量管理、设备管理、数据采集等。了解这些功能模块是维护MES系统的基础。
二、SQL在MES系统中的应用
SQL(结构化查询语言)是用于数据库操作的标准语言。在MES系统中,SQL主要用于数据的查询、更新和管理。利用SQL,维护人员可以从数据库中提取关键信息,生成报表,进行数据分析等。例如,在生产过程中,维护人员可以使用SQL查询设备的运行状态,分析故障原因,优化设备维护策略。 此外,SQL还可用于设置触发器和存储过程,以自动化某些数据处理流程,提高系统的响应速度和准确性。掌握SQL技能,有助于维护人员更好地理解数据流动和处理机制,但仅凭这一技能,难以全面掌握MES系统的维护。
三、维护MES系统的其他技能要求
维护MES系统不仅需要SQL技能,还需要其他多方面的知识和能力。例如,系统架构的理解、业务流程的掌握、硬件接口的配置等都是必不可少的。 维护人员需要了解MES系统如何与ERP、SCADA(监控和数据采集系统)等其他系统进行集成,以确保数据的准确性和实时性。此外, MES系统的维护涉及到网络配置、服务器管理、数据备份和恢复等技术要求,维护人员应具备一定的IT基础和系统架构知识。综合这些技能,才能更有效地维护和优化MES系统。
四、常见的MES系统维护挑战
在实际维护MES系统的过程中,维护人员可能会面临多种挑战。例如,系统升级时可能出现兼容性问题,数据丢失或损坏的风险,以及实时数据处理的压力等。 解决这些问题需要维护人员具备良好的问题解决能力和应变能力。例如,在系统升级时,维护人员需要提前进行充分的测试,确保所有功能模块能够正常运行,避免因系统不稳定导致的生产中断。此外,对于实时数据处理的压力,维护人员需要优化数据库的性能,合理配置硬件资源,以确保系统能够稳定运行。
五、如何提升维护MES系统的能力
要提升维护MES系统的能力,维护人员可以从多个方面入手。首先,持续学习新技术和更新知识是提升能力的关键。 参加相关的培训课程、行业会议,或者通过在线学习平台获取最新的技术知识。此外,建立与其他维护人员的交流与合作,分享经验和解决方案,也是提升能力的重要途径。通过参与实际项目,积累经验,能够帮助维护人员更好地理解MES系统的复杂性,提高处理问题的效率和准确性。
六、总结
维护MES系统并不是一项单一技能就能完成的任务,虽然SQL在数据管理中扮演着重要角色,但要全面维护MES系统,维护人员需要具备多方面的知识和技能。只有通过不断学习和实践,才能够胜任这一复杂的工作。
1年前 -
只会 SQL 是否能够维护 MES 系统?答案是有限的。 SQL(结构化查询语言)确实是进行数据管理和查询的核心工具,但维护 MES(制造执行系统)系统涉及的不仅仅是数据管理。MES 系统的维护通常需要掌握系统架构、应用逻辑、接口管理等多个方面的知识和技能。具体来说,仅仅掌握 SQL 可能无法应对系统的复杂配置、问题排查及优化,因为这些任务还涉及到系统的业务流程、硬件接口和用户界面等其他技术领域的知识。接下来,将详细探讨维护 MES 系统所需的全面技能和知识。
一、理解 MES 系统架构
MES 系统的架构包括多个层面:数据库层、应用层、用户界面层和接口层。了解这些层面及其相互作用对于维护 MES 系统至关重要。数据库层存储了 MES 系统的核心数据,包括生产计划、生产执行记录和设备状态等。应用层则是系统的逻辑核心,负责业务流程的实现和处理。用户界面层负责与用户的交互,提供操作界面和显示信息。接口层则是系统与其他外部系统(如 ERP 系统、SCADA 系统等)的连接桥梁。
维护数据库层的知识主要涉及 SQL 的高级使用,包括优化查询性能、维护数据库完整性、以及处理数据迁移等任务。然而,仅仅了解这些是不够的,还需要对 MES 系统的业务逻辑有深刻的理解,以确保数据库操作能够正确反映业务需求。理解系统架构的关键在于能够识别各层的功能,并有效地处理每个层面的问题。
二、掌握 MES 业务流程
MES 系统通常与生产线的各个环节紧密相关,包括生产计划、生产调度、质量管理、设备维护等。掌握 MES 系统的业务流程能够帮助维护人员快速定位问题源并实施修复。例如,了解生产调度流程可以帮助识别调度不准确的问题;熟悉质量管理流程可以优化质量控制模块。
业务流程的掌握包括:了解生产线的每个环节如何与 MES 系统交互、熟悉业务规则和数据流转、以及能够识别和解决由于业务逻辑导致的系统问题。这些知识不仅帮助维护人员更好地理解系统行为,还能在遇到问题时进行有效的故障排除和修复。
三、熟悉系统接口和集成
MES 系统通常与其他系统(如 ERP 系统、SCADA 系统、设备控制系统等)集成。系统接口的维护包括确保数据在不同系统之间的正确流动,处理接口调用中的错误,并进行必要的系统集成测试。掌握系统接口的知识涉及到了解不同系统的接口协议、数据格式和传输机制,以及能够配置和维护这些接口以确保系统的整体协调和功能正常。
接口管理的技巧包括:能够对接口日志进行分析,识别数据传输中的异常;配置和调整接口参数,以解决集成问题;和使用调试工具来测试接口的稳定性和可靠性。接口的维护工作需要细致入微的技术知识和实际操作经验。
四、解决 MES 系统故障
故障排除是 MES 系统维护中的重要环节。MES 系统故障可能源于多个方面,包括数据错误、应用程序缺陷、硬件故障等。解决故障的能力依赖于对系统组件的全面理解:从数据库查询、应用逻辑到硬件设备的调试,每一部分都可能成为故障的根源。
故障排除的步骤:收集并分析系统日志,定位问题发生的具体区域;使用调试工具进行系统测试,以验证故障原因;结合业务流程和系统架构的知识,制定和实施解决方案。有效的故障排除需要跨领域的知识和丰富的实践经验。
五、进行系统优化和升级
系统优化和升级是保持 MES 系统高效运行的重要措施。系统优化包括调整数据库性能、改进应用程序逻辑、优化用户界面等。系统升级则涉及到引入新功能、修复已知漏洞和增强系统的安全性。优化和升级的工作通常需要深入理解系统的工作原理和业务需求。
优化的常见措施:通过分析性能瓶颈,调整数据库索引,优化 SQL 查询;改进应用程序逻辑,以提升系统响应速度和用户体验;更新系统配置,以适应新的业务需求和技术环境。系统升级则涉及到对新版本的兼容性测试和逐步部署,以确保平滑过渡和系统稳定性。
总的来说,虽然 SQL 是 MES 系统维护的一个重要工具,但全面的 MES 系统维护需要更多的知识和技能。包括系统架构理解、业务流程掌握、接口管理、故障排除和系统优化等方面的知识,都是确保 MES 系统正常运行和持续改进的关键。
1年前 -
只会SQL无法完全维护MES系统、MES系统维护需要多方面的技能、了解系统架构与业务流程是关键。 MES(制造执行系统)是一种重要的工厂信息化系统,它能够实时监控生产过程、优化资源利用、提高生产效率。虽然SQL(结构化查询语言)在数据管理和数据库操作中扮演着重要角色,但仅仅掌握SQL无法满足MES系统维护的所有需求。MES系统的维护不仅需要良好的SQL技能,还需要对系统的整体架构有深入了解,包括硬件、软件、网络,以及与其他系统(如ERP、PLM等)的集成。此外,维护人员还需熟悉具体的业务流程,能够根据实际需求进行系统配置和调整。因此,具备多方面的技术能力和业务知识,才能够高效地维护MES系统。
一、MES系统的基本概念
MES(制造执行系统)是连接企业计划与生产之间的桥梁。它的主要功能包括生产调度、资源管理、质量管理、数据采集等,旨在优化生产过程,提高企业的生产效率和灵活性。MES系统通过实时监控生产状态,帮助企业及时调整生产计划,减少停机时间,提高资源利用率。MES系统通常与其他企业管理系统(如ERP、SCADA等)紧密集成,共同构成了企业的信息化系统架构。
在现代制造业中,MES系统的应用愈发重要。随着智能制造和工业4.0概念的兴起,MES系统不仅仅是一个数据采集工具,更是推动企业数字化转型的核心部分。通过对生产过程的全面监控和数据分析,MES系统可以帮助企业实现生产可视化、智能化和自动化,从而在激烈的市场竞争中占据优势。
二、MES系统的组成部分
一个完整的MES系统通常由多个组件组成,包括数据采集层、应用层和用户界面层。
-
数据采集层:这一层负责实时获取生产现场的数据,包括设备状态、生产进度、产品质量等信息。数据采集可以通过传感器、PLC(可编程逻辑控制器)等硬件设备来实现。
-
应用层:这是MES系统的核心部分,负责数据的处理和分析。应用层包括生产调度、质量管理、资源管理等模块。这些模块通过对采集到的数据进行处理,生成实时的生产报告和分析结果,帮助企业决策。
-
用户界面层:这一层面向用户,提供友好的操作界面。用户可以通过图形化界面查看生产数据、调整生产计划、进行质量分析等操作。
综合来看,MES系统的各个组成部分相辅相成,形成一个完整的生产管理体系。理解每个部分的功能和作用,对于维护和优化MES系统至关重要。
三、SQL在MES系统中的作用
SQL作为一种数据库查询语言,在MES系统中扮演着重要角色。MES系统通常需要处理大量的生产数据,而这些数据通常存储在关系型数据库中。因此,熟练掌握SQL对于MES系统的维护至关重要。
-
数据查询:通过SQL,维护人员可以快速查询生产数据,生成报表,分析生产效率和质量问题。
-
数据更新:在MES系统中,生产状态和资源信息需要及时更新。通过SQL,维护人员可以对数据库中的记录进行增删改操作,确保系统数据的准确性和实时性。
-
数据分析:SQL支持复杂的查询和数据分析,维护人员可以使用SQL对生产数据进行统计和分析,识别生产瓶颈、质量问题,从而提出改进建议。
虽然SQL在数据管理中非常重要,但仅凭这一技能并不足以全面维护MES系统。维护人员还需要具备其他技术和业务知识。
四、MES系统维护需要的技能
维护MES系统涉及多方面的技能,除了SQL,以下技能也是必不可少的:
-
系统架构知识:了解MES系统的整体架构,包括数据库、服务器、网络等。维护人员需要知道各个组件如何协同工作,以便在出现问题时能够迅速定位并解决。
-
编程能力:熟练掌握至少一种编程语言(如Java、C#等),能够开发和维护MES系统中的自定义功能,满足企业特定的业务需求。
-
网络知识:MES系统通常需要与其他系统进行数据交互,维护人员需要了解网络协议、数据传输等基本知识,以确保系统的正常运行。
-
业务流程理解:熟悉企业的生产流程和业务需求,能够根据实际情况调整MES系统的配置,以适应不断变化的生产环境。
-
问题解决能力:在维护过程中,难免会遇到各种问题,维护人员需要具备较强的问题分析和解决能力,能够迅速响应并处理系统故障。
这些技能相辅相成,缺一不可。只有具备全面的技能,才能够高效地维护和优化MES系统。
五、学习和提升MES系统维护能力的方法
为了提升MES系统的维护能力,维护人员可以从以下几个方面入手:
-
参加培训课程:许多软件公司和专业机构提供MES系统相关的培训课程,维护人员可以通过参加这些课程,系统地学习MES系统的功能和维护技巧。
-
获得认证:一些MES软件提供商会提供认证课程,获得相关认证不仅能证明个人的专业能力,还能提升在行业内的竞争力。
-
实践经验:在实际工作中积累经验是提升技能的重要途径。维护人员可以通过参与项目实施、系统升级、故障处理等实际工作,快速提升自己的能力。
-
技术社区和论坛:参与技术社区和论坛,与其他专业人士交流,分享经验和解决方案,能够帮助维护人员拓宽视野,获取最新的行业动态和技术发展趋势。
-
持续学习:MES系统和相关技术在不断发展,维护人员需要保持学习的习惯,关注新技术、新工具的出现,及时更新自己的知识库。
通过这些方法,维护人员可以不断提升自己的能力,适应快速变化的制造业环境。
六、MES系统维护中的常见挑战
在实际维护过程中,维护人员常常会面临一些挑战,主要包括:
-
系统集成问题:MES系统通常需要与其他系统(如ERP、SCADA)进行集成,系统之间的数据交互和兼容性问题可能导致系统运行不稳定。
-
数据安全性:MES系统涉及大量的生产数据,数据安全和隐私保护成为维护中的重要问题。维护人员需要采取有效的安全措施,防止数据泄露和丢失。
-
用户培训:MES系统的使用涉及到不同的用户,如何对用户进行有效培训,提高他们的使用技能和理解能力,是维护工作中的一大挑战。
-
系统更新和升级:随着技术的不断发展,MES系统也需要定期进行更新和升级,以保持系统的高效性和安全性。维护人员需要提前规划,避免对生产造成影响。
面对这些挑战,维护人员需要具备灵活应变的能力和解决问题的思维,才能顺利应对各种突发情况。
七、总结与展望
MES系统的维护是一项复杂的工作,除了熟练掌握SQL外,还需要具备多方面的技能和知识。维护人员应不断学习和提升自己的能力,以适应快速发展的制造业环境。通过了解MES系统的基本概念、组成部分和维护要求,维护人员能够更好地应对维护中的各种挑战,提高系统的稳定性和效率。
未来,随着智能制造和工业4.0的推进,MES系统将进一步发展,维护人员需要关注新技术的应用,如大数据、云计算和人工智能等,以推动MES系统的创新和优化。同时,保持与行业的紧密联系,了解市场趋势和客户需求,将有助于提升企业竞争力,实现可持续发展。
1年前 -
-
只会SQL能否维护MES系统? 答案是有限的。 MES(制造执行系统)通常涉及到复杂的数据管理和系统集成,需要综合运用多种技能和知识。虽然掌握SQL对于管理数据库至关重要,但维护和操作MES系统通常还需要额外的技能和知识,包括对系统架构、业务流程、硬件设备的了解,以及对特定MES平台的熟悉程度。
一、SQL的重要性与局限性
SQL(结构化查询语言)是操作和管理关系型数据库的核心工具。在MES系统中,SQL能够帮助管理员执行数据查询、更新和维护任务。这种能力对维护系统的数据库层面是非常重要的。掌握SQL可以让你有效地检索和操作数据,保证数据的准确性和完整性,这对于解决数据相关的问题至关重要。然而,仅仅会SQL并不足以完全掌握和维护MES系统,因为MES系统不仅仅涉及数据操作,还涉及到复杂的业务逻辑、系统配置和集成需求。
二、MES系统的复杂性
MES系统涉及到多种功能模块,包括生产调度、质量管理、设备管理等。这些模块通常需要与企业资源计划(ERP)系统、供应链管理系统和其他业务系统进行集成。维护MES系统需要对这些模块的功能和相互关系有深刻的理解,而这远超了SQL的应用范围。除了数据操作,还需要对系统的配置、优化和故障排除有深入的了解。
三、系统配置与业务流程
MES系统的配置通常涉及到复杂的业务规则和流程设置。这包括定义生产流程、设定设备参数、配置工艺路线等。这些配置工作需要对生产管理和企业业务流程有深入的理解,并且需要对MES系统提供的配置工具和界面有一定的熟悉度。仅仅会SQL无法完成这些配置任务,因为这些操作不仅涉及到数据层面,还涉及到系统的业务逻辑和工作流程的调整。
四、系统集成与接口开发
现代MES系统通常需要与其他系统进行数据交换和集成,包括ERP系统、PLC控制系统等。集成工作可能涉及到API接口开发、数据转换和实时数据流的处理。这些任务需要具备一定的编程能力和系统集成经验。SQL技能虽然在数据查询和处理上很有用,但在系统集成方面则需要更广泛的技术背景和经验。
五、故障排除与支持
维护MES系统还需要处理系统故障和提供技术支持。故障排除不仅涉及到数据问题,还可能涉及到硬件故障、系统配置错误以及网络问题等。这种综合性的技术支持需要对系统的各个层面有全面的了解,包括系统架构、操作系统、网络环境等。只会SQL的人员可能无法独立处理这些复杂的问题,因为这些问题的解决通常需要更广泛的技术知识和经验。
总的来说,只会SQL对于MES系统的维护能力是有限的。虽然SQL对于数据管理非常重要,但维护一个完整的MES系统需要掌握更多的技术和知识,涉及到系统配置、业务流程、集成开发和故障排除等多个方面。
1年前
















































《零代码开发知识图谱》
《零代码
新动能》案例集
《企业零代码系统搭建指南》









领先企业,真实声音
简道云让业务用户感受数字化的效果,加速数字化落地;零代码快速开发迭代提供了很低的试错成本,孵化了一批新工具新方法。
郑炯蒙牛乳业信息技术高级总监
简道云把各模块数据整合到一起,工作效率得到质的提升。现在赛艇协会遇到新的业务需求时,会直接用简道云开发demo,基本一天完成。
谭威正中国赛艇协会数据总监
业务与技术交织,让思维落地实现。四年简道云使用经历,功能越来越多也反推业务流程转变,是促使我们成长的过程。实现了真正降本增效。
袁超OPPO(苏皖)信息化部门负责人
零代码的无门槛开发方式盘活了全公司信息化推进的热情和效率,简道云打破了原先集团的数据孤岛困局,未来将继续向数据要生产力。
伍学纲东方日升新能源股份有限公司副总裁
通过简道云零代码技术的运用实践,提高了企业转型速度、减少对高技术专业人员的依赖。在应用推广上,具备员工上手快的竞争优势。
董兴潮绿城建筑科技集团信息化专业经理
简道云是目前最贴合我们实际业务的信息化产品。通过灵活的自定义平台,实现了信息互通、闭环管理,企业管理效率真正得到了提升。
王磊克吕士科学仪器(上海)有限公司总经理